He could find many novels about transmigrating into the deposed Crown Prince Li Chengqian. One of them was " The Rebirth of Li Chengqian, the Crown Prince of the Tang Dynasty ", which told the story of a modern otaku who traveled to the 17th year of Zhenguan in the Tang Dynasty and became the Crown Prince Li Chengqian. Crown Prince Li Chengqian was facing the crisis of deposing the Crown Prince. The people around him also had ulterior motives and constantly encouraged him to rebel. The other novel was " Tang Dynasty: Starting from the Deposed Crown Prince's Registration ". The story was about the deposed Crown Prince Li Chengqian awakening the registration system after he was exiled to Qianzhou. Through his efforts and contributions, the deposed Crown Prince was praised and respected by the people. There was also a novel called " The Great Tang: Self-Deposing the Crown Prince at the Beginning ", which told the story of a 21st-century teenager who accidentally transmigrated to become the Crown Prince of the Great Tang, Li Chengqian.
